    The best Ayce sushi place in Vegas!…read more If you're tired of the boring buffets on the strip, I highly recommend to visitors to check out this restaurant off the strip in Chinatown. Food (4.5/5) I strongly recommend to order the nigiri and stay away from the rolls if you want to get your moneys worth. The nigiri selection is pretty huge with multiple unique cuts of fish that other Ayce sushi places usually don't include (surf clam, ono, yellowtail toro, uni). Although some of the premium items you're only allowed to order once, it was pretty satisfying to be able to even try it as most ayce sushi places don't even include these items. The nigiri is on the smaller side (maybe 1/2 the size of regular size nigiri) but I appreciate how they didn't include a ton of sushi rice with each piece. It seemed like this restaurant wanted you to get your moneys worth and not have you fill up on rice! Highlight items are definitely everything on the special nigiri order menu selection, eel nigiri, and seared salmon. The regular tuna nigiri was just alright and my group did not like the ikura as it was a little off tasting. They also include free ice cream at the end and the affogado was pretty good! Service (4.75/5) The service was pretty good for such a small and packed place. We went right at opening and it was completely full with a long wait outside on a Sunday afternoon. The best part of this place is that there is NO item ordering restriction so essentially you could order 100+ nigiri for a single round of ordering. Most ayce sushi places I've eaten at have very shady rules that try to screw you over so you can't order a lot, but this place took the opposite approach so I can see why it's always busy! The staff was very quick at bringing out the food and having you order again. There is a 90 minute time limit to eat so start ordering right away. Ambience (4.5/5) This restaurant is located in a strip mall plaza in Chinatown and the parking was limited, but once inside this restaurant was pretty cute with the decorations. It felt clean and had a nice cool A/C going inside. Value (5/5) 20$ lunch until 4pm on Monday-Thursday and 35$ all other times. The best value AYCE I've had and better than anything I've paid for in California. Overall (4.68/5) I would definitely return to Vegas just to eat here again and I thought the food quality was better than any Bacchanal or Wynn Buffet on the strip.

    Shigotonin is a delightful discovery off the Vegas strip (but may as well be on the strip…read moreconsidering the taste and quality of food here) in a small plaza. Chef Shuji runs the restaurant with his wife next to him in the kitchen. The fish here is flown in from Japan and of the highest quality as you can see from the sheen and fat marbling. The tuna melts in your mouth and bite after bite is a wonderful experience as you pair it with soy sauce, fresh Wasabi, yuzu Wasabi, or some combination of the condiments provided. This is also the first sushi restaurant I have ever been to that automatically brings out fresh Wasabi without having to ask. The portions are generous and we left feeling very satisfied. Even though we were very full, we took a look at the dessert menu. Not pictured here is a sweet potato with ice cream and brown sugar glaze. This dish on the menu was unassuming but the taste was so decadent. Quite possibly the best and sweetest sweet potato I have ever tasted. The chef slowly roasts them over a 2 hour period, rotating the potatoes every so slightly every 15 minutes. The sweet potato could be a dessert by itself, it was that good! Chef Shuji is a charming and funny host. He regularly comes out to greet his customers and makes sure they are enjoying their meal, very high-touch. If you know Japanese - even if it's just a few phrases, speak with him as he will be delighted. He was absolutely tickled when we said arigato and he shared that he is originally from Kyoto. Cannot wait to return to Shigotonin!
